This is a sequel to Tales From The Dragon Mountain: The Strix. I played both games back to back. You should really play the first game before playing this one. Pure adventure with no hidden objects scenes. This is an SE game with CE perks. There are collectible dragons & achievements Definitely worth a free game code!
Too many people are spoiled by the new HOPAs out there. For those of you who still appreciate old school adventure games this one is a lot of fun. You of course have some point & click adventure. There are puzzles, a bit of HO action and a couple Match 3 boards. I liked the way they did them. Not a lot of back & forth. Once you finish a chapter witch includes several areas you move on. The story is actually good. A couple of the characters have VERY annoying voices so I am going to ding this a star. Use one of your free game codes on it :)
